Sporting Alfas Cricket Club 1st X1 T20 v Madrid CC on Sat 06 Apr 2024 at 10:30
Sporting Alfas Cricket Club Won
Match report
Day 2.
SACC won the toss and elected to bat first on this occasion, some of the home team suffering from the effect Benidorm can inflict on the younger minds of our squad. Madrid CC, this time the opposition, with the knowledge that playing regular cricket down here on the Woodbridge Oval on Boulevard Dels Musica in L´Albir, Alfas Del Pi. could cause SACC a few problems. Problem is the Madrid players also enjoyed a night out and could not find an answer to the opening batsman from SACC Christian Muñoz Mills was disappointed with his performance last evening so along with the in-form Gary Crompton took the score to a very impressive 217 from the 20 allotted overs. Christian ending on 103 with Gary reaching 95 very unlucky not to reach his century also. SACC bowling was by now in a steadier position with regular tea and coffee being drank out of our ´shed´. Openers Sunderland and Jamshaid proofing far to accurate for the travellers, Sunderland taking 2 wickets for 5 runs from his opening spell and Jamshaid equally impressive with only 8 coming from his 2 over spell. Sporting Alfas are as always very sporting, so the ball was given to a couple of lads yet to bowl in the competition, Iqbal and Agirrezabalaga, better known as Aitor, Iqbal going for 2 4´s off his first two balls but returned figures of 1 - 13 - 2 and Aitor getting 0 - 39- 4. Time for the newest SACC superstar to get his chance and Clinton Martiz yet again supplied the goods taking 4 wickets for 9 runs from his 3 over spell. Madrid CC reaching 122 with Galliano the only player giving much resistance to the SACC attack he was amongst the victims of Martiz.
